The story of Eva Schilling began in 1887 in Austria, Hungary. Eva Schilling married Andras Andreas Andrew John Redenbacher Rodenbucher 2Ggf U S Railroad Worker, and had children including Andrew John Rodenbucher, Andrew John Rodenbucher Jr 1St Gg Uncle, Anna Rodenbucher Papiska 1Gg Aunt, Anthony George Tony Papiska 1St Gg Uncle, Carole Anne Papiska 1Gg Aunt, David Rudolph Papiska 1St Gg Uncle, Elizabeth Ann Papiska Henderson 1Gg Aunt, Joseph Papiska, Philip Edward Papiska, Rosella Johanna Papiska 1St Gg Aunt, Rozal Rosaty Rosalie Rose Schilling Stahl Stahle Graetz Steele Steola Klump Mendel Pauling Papiska Rodenbucher Rodenbacher 1St Ggm Ssn 569 07 6601. Eva Schilling passed away in 1972 in Inglewood, Los Angeles, California, USA.
